Transaction 869ab95143a4044000f65d2d16eda638e7a64d567736d241a3ffb77a3ee1684e
1 Input
1 Output
-
869ab95143a4044000f65d2d16eda638e7a64d567736d241a3ffb77a3ee1684e:0
- value
- 71339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bc5337773231e48553621df111c7392bac93c5a OP_EQUAL
- address
- 3BWrTqZsSu3iteM4cwZ7ucDv1oCxpCCmak